SENSITIVITY ANALYSIS OF PUBLIC SECTOR PROJECTS -- WATER SUPPLY PLANS








1. Let x = weighting per factor



Since there are 6 factors and one (environmental considerations) is to have a weighting that is double the others, its weighting is 2x. Thus,



2x + x + x + x + x + x = 100

7x = 100

x = 14.3%



Therefore, the environmental weighting is 2(14.3), or 28.6%

3. For alternative 4 to be as economically attractive as alternative 3, its total annual cost would have to be the same as that of alternative 3, which is $3,881,879. Thus, if P4 is the capital investment,



3,881,879 = P4(A/P, 8%, 20) + 1,063,449

3,881,879 = P4(0.10185) + 1,063,449

P4 = $27,672,361

Decrease = 29,000,000 – 27,672,361

= $1,327,639 or 4.58%
